Discovery and Repair Service of Water Leakage in Restroom


Water leakage in shower room frequently results from pipes as well as pipe mistakes. There are numerous types of washroom leakages. You might need a fundamental knowledge of these leakage kinds to spot the water leak in shower room. Below are the usual washroom leakages and also fix suggestions:

Splash Leaks


These often result from water splashing on the washroom floor from the bath tub. It harms the shower room flooring as well as may cause rot to wood floors and washroom doors.

What to Do


If the leak has actually damaged the washroom floor or door, you might need to alter these to avoid more damages. The good news is that you can include a pipes expert to help with the shower room repair service.

Bathroom Leaks


Sometimes, water leakages from the bathroom as well as pools around the commode base. It is an eyesore in the shower room and requires prompt interest.

What to Do


You only require to tighten them if there are loose bolts in between the tank as well as toilet. Sometimes you might require to reapply wax on the gasket or call a washroom leakage expert to replace broken or used parts.

Clogged Washroom Sinks


Often, the water leak in bathroom arises from sink clogs. This is usually an annoyance to property owners and also may be undesirable. Blockages may result from the build-up of soap scum, hair bits, or particles that block the drain. It is simple to take care of obstructions, and also you may not need specialist abilities.

What to Do


You can make use of a drain snake to eliminate the particles in the drainpipe and let the stagnant water flow. Drain cleansers are likewise offered in stores and also are very easy to utilize.

SIGNS OF A HIDDEN WATER LEAK IN YOUR BATHROOM


Musty smell


One of the most visible indications of a leak is a musty, earthy smell similar to what you may find in an old basement. Smells like this means that water is accumulating with no way for it to dry due to water constantly pouring out and a lack of the necessary conditions for the water to evaporate. It is important to note that this smell is a symptom and not the problem itself, but can be a strong hint that the following issues will take place.


Mold outside of the shower


It’s not uncommon for mold to form inside your shower because it is wet constantly, so you c some mold in the corners can be expected. However, the problem arises when mold becomes visible in the parts of your bathroom that are typically dry, like non-shower walls, floors, and ceilings. Mold growth in these areas can signal that there is water feeding it beneath the surface.


Loss of structural integrity of the bathroom’s surfaces



Accumulation of a large amount of water can have severe and damaging effects on walls, floors, and ceilings beyond mold growth. We will work our way from the bottom to the top of your bathroom. A leak can cause dark stains to appear on the floor of the bathroom from saturating with water. Additionally, a hidden leak can make the floor feel spongey when to walk on and impact the surface itself, like causing loose tiles.



As for walls, a leak can cause the drywall to deform and lead to bubbling, warping, and even deteriorating. This dilemma can be particularly expensive and intensive to fix because the drywall may need to be torn out and replaced in addition to finding the leak. Another sign of a hidden leak involves the wallpaper, which due to moisture building up behind it between the wall can cause it to hang off of the wall.


Stains on the ceiling in rooms below the bathroom


Similar to the walls in the bathroom itself, water can accumulate and lead to dark stains. However, these can be present on the ceiling of the room directly beneath the bathroom. Also just like bathroom walls, this can be a hassle to fix because patches of the ceiling may need to replaced.


High water bills



The final telltale sign that you have a hidden leak won’t be present in your bathroom, but in your wallet. Monitor your water bill and water use to see if they match up correctly. A monthly statement that shows more water consumption than expected may be the result of a leak. Fixing the leak should help stabilize your bill.
